Except Dawn of War II wasn't a horrible successor because it was less tactful. It can debatably be considered a lesser successor for other reasons, but Dawn of War II was much more tactful in terms of unit control and unit positioning because of its cover system and shock tactics-style of gameplay. Dawn of War I is far less concerned with unit positioning and individual unit control and more concerned with smashing units into each other with "A-move".
Dawn of War I pathfinding is the worst in the series.
Dawn of War I does not have better graphics than Dawn of War III. Dawn of War I looks dated because it is dated. Dawn of War III is shinier and brighter than Dawn of War I, which is more of an aesthetic art style – an aesthetic art style that you don't seem to prefer over the "grim dark" tone (which is understandable).
You not considering Dawn of War II gameplay to be fun is a personal opinion. If anything, I would argue that gameplay, positioning and combat are far simpler in Dawn of War I and could be considered to be more akin to "whack-a-mole" in comparison to Dawn of War II.

Anyone who knows how much effort from the community went into finally getting Age of Empires II rebooted into HD edition would know this is a very resource-intensive request and not at all that cheap for Relic/SEGA. Working with the older engines is much more difficult as it does not allow the ease of regression testing the newer engines allow; that's without mention to fix the flaws of vanilla would basically require it being rebuilt on a newer engine.
I agree, it would be great to get vanilla remastered but I have to discredit some of the reasoning raised.
